1. Palace of Parliament or People’s House

This is arguably Bucharest’s most famous landmark — and a must-see for anyone interested in Romania’s recent history. Standing outside the Palace of Parliament, you’ll quickly grasp the scale of Romania’s communist era. As you approach, your guide will share stories about how this building, after all, is the second-largest administrative complex in the world, only after the Pentagon.

What makes this stop particularly powerful is the storytelling about the dangers of totalitarian regimes. One reviewer, Angela, appreciated her guide’s ability to tailor the experience and keep the conversation lively, making this otherwise heavy topic more approachable. Expect to feel small looking up at its enormous facade, and to reflect on the megalomania that built it.

2. Muzeul National al Satului “Dimitrie Gusti” (Village Museum)

This open-air museum is like a trip through Romanian rural history. You’ll see traditional wooden houses, churches, and communal structures that represent different regions of the country. The guide will help contextualize how these structures symbolize a sustainable, ecological lifestyle rooted in simple, community-focused living.

While entry isn’t included in the tour price, it’s well worth the small extra fee for the authentic experience of wandering among these preserved buildings. Many travelers love how this stop offers a visual and tactile connection to Romania’s cultural roots—something that digital or static museums can’t quite replicate.

3. Calea Victoriei (Victory Avenue)

Walking along Calea Victoriei, you’ll encounter a layered history that tells stories from royal courts, communist regimes, and modern-day Bucharest. Your guide’s insights will help you decode the contradictions: the grandeur of the Royal Palace versus the starkness of the Communist Party headquarters.

This street is a vibrant mosaic of architecture, shops, theaters, and churches. You’ll see landmarks like the Romanian Athenaeum, the CEC Palace, and the historic churches that seem to hold centuries of stories. The guide will point out the hidden details in the architecture and share anecdotes about Romania’s tumultuous political past.

4. Revolution Square

This is where history was made — the site of Nicolae Ceausescu’s fall in December 1989. Standing before the former Central Committee building and the monument to the revolution, you’ll get a sense of the upheaval that changed Romania’s course.

The guide details the events that unfolded here, adding context to the secrets and controversies that still linger. Several reviews mention the powerful feeling of standing in the square, contemplating the sacrifices made. It’s an emotional but essential part of understanding Bucharest’s modern identity.

5. Old Town (Lipscani District)

The Old Town is where Bucharest’s past and present collide. Your guide will lead you through Hanul Lui Manuc, a historic inn that once served as a bustling commercial hub. Today, it’s a lively area filled with cafes, restaurants, and small museums.

Here, you can soak up the cosmopolitan atmosphere, observe the contrasts of old and new, and imagine the city’s evolution over centuries. The tour’s focus on storytelling means you’ll learn about the merchants, artisans, and revolutionaries who shaped this neighborhood.
